[单选题]

下面程序的输出结果 ( ) main( ) {unsigned a=32768; printf("a=%d/n",a);}

A.a=32768

B.a=32767

C.a=-32768

D.a=-1

参考答案与解析:

相关试题

下列程序的输出结果是______。main(){unsigned short a

[单选题]下列程序的输出结果是______。 main() { unsigned short a=65536;int b; printf("%d/n",b:a); }A.0B.1C.2D.3

  • 查看答案
  • 下面程序的输出结果是_______。unsigned fun(unsigned

    [单选题]下面程序的输出结果是_______。 unsigned fun(unsigned num) { unsigned k=1; do { k*=num%10; num/=10; }while(num); return(k); } main() { unsigned n=26; printf("%d/n",fun(n)); }A.0B.4C.12D.无限次循环

  • 查看答案
  • 下面程序输出结果是 ______。#includevoid main(){ in

    [单选题]下面程序输出结果是 ______。includevoid main(){ int a,b,c;a=6;b=c=4;if(a!=B)i下面程序输出结果是 ______。 #include<iostream. h> void main(){ int a,b,c; a=6;b=c=4; if(a!=B) if(a!=B) if(a) cout<<(a-->2); else a++; else a+=a; cout<<a; }A.15B.7C.12D.17

  • 查看答案
  • 下面程序的输出结果为______。 #include main() { char

    [单选题]下面程序的输出结果为______。 include main() { char p1[7]="abc",p2[]="ABC",str[50下面程序的输出结果为______。 #include<string.h> main() { char p1[7]="abc",p2[]="ABC",str[50]="xyz"; strcpy(str,strcat(p1,p2)); printf("%s",str); }A.xyzabcABCB.abcABCC.xyzabcD.xyzAB

  • 查看答案
  • 以下程序的结果是 ( ) main( ) { unsigned int a=3,

    [单选题]以下程序的结果是 ( ) main( ) { unsigned int a=3,b=10; printf("%d/n",a1); }A.1B以下程序的结果是 ( )main( ){ unsigned int a=3,b=10;printf("%d/n",a<<2|b>>1);}A.1B.5C.12D.13

  • 查看答案
  • 下面程序的输出结果是 #include #includevoid main( )

    [单选题]下面程序的输出结果是 include includevoid main( ) { char p1[10] ,p2下面程序的输出结果是#include<iostream.h>#include<string.h>void main( ){char p1[10] ,p2[10] ;strcpy(p1,"abc") ;strcpy(p2,"ABC") ;char str[50] ="xyz";strcpy(str+2,strcat(p1,p2) ) ;cout < < str;}A.xyza

  • 查看答案
  • 下面程序的输出结果为______ include void main() {co

    [主观题]下面程序的输出结果为______ include void main() {cout<<"Hello/b"; }下面程序的输出结果为______include<iostream.h>void main(){cout<<"Hello/b";}

  • 查看答案
  • 以下程序的输出结果是unsigned fun6(unsigned num){ u

    [试题]以下程序的输出结果是unsigned fun6(unsigned num){ unsigned k=1; do{k *=num%10;num/=10;} while (num); return k;}main(){ unsigned n=26; printf("%d\n", fun6(n));}

  • 查看答案
  • 下面程序输出的结果是 #include void main( ) { inti;

    [单选题]下面程序输出的结果是 include void main( ) { inti; int a[3] [3] ={1,2,3,4,5,6,下面程序输出的结果是#include<iostream.h>void main( ){ inti;int a[3] [3] ={1,2,3,4,5,6,7,8,91;for(i=0;i<3;i++)cout < < a[2-i] [i] < < " ";}A.1 5 9B.7 5 3C.3 5 7D.5 9 1

  • 查看答案
  • 下面程序的输出结果是()。#include#includevoid main()

    [单选题]下面程序的输出结果是()。includeincludevoid main(){char p1[10],p2[10下面程序的输出结果是( )。 #include<iostream.h> #include<string.h> void main() { char p1[10],p2[10]; strcpy(p1,”abc”); strcpy(p2,”ABC”); charsty[50]=“xyz”; strcpy(str+2,strcat(p1,p2)); cout<<str; }A.xyzabcA

  • 查看答案
  • 下面程序的输出结果 ( ) main( ) {unsigned a=32768;